Shoot 1 Contact Sheet

When shooting digitally I, nearly, always use a tripod. This enables for a highly accurate use of bracketed exposures which are then processed later using HDR. This helps to get a range of exposure to combine together and produce images which have greater depth.

When marking my contact sheets I have used coloured lines to connect which images belong in the bracketed triplets. Brackets were set at 1 stops difference providing a zero exposure as well as a +1 and a -1.
